Transaction 7deb71f741a655ae8fd4d0741a006ca35e333520a0625d2187c44ee95b5cd77a
1 Input
1 Output
-
7deb71f741a655ae8fd4d0741a006ca35e333520a0625d2187c44ee95b5cd77a:0
- value
- 304157
- script pubkey
- OP_0 OP_PUSHBYTES_20 d2edcab93661e594a1f942aeb845045a4f07140c
- address
- bc1q6tku4wfkv8jefg0eg2hts3gytf8sw9qv0sa25t